4cyl turbo engine, less displacement but the air intake is compressed, more air, more gas needed for the a/f mixture= less gas mileage. A lot of people think that all 4 cyl engines get really good gas mileage...which isnt the case when they are performance based. The wing is easily swapped out with a regular impreza or a WRX (im not a big fan of it either), but hoodscoop is functional, which means to remove it you would need a front mounted intercooler (not very effective for subarus because of where the turbo is located) or some type of custom watercooled system. I get 18-20 city miles in the 2.0ltr WRX (stage 2 about 300hp@16psi). I've never heard of the 2.0 WRX getting worse mileage than the 2.5, the 2.5 is actually rated at slightly worse for mpg (20/27 vs. 20/26 respectively, and the STi is at 18/24). Makes sense, same turbo but 25% larger displacement to fill. Quote:
